Walter Denaut (1807-1889) was a prosperous and widely renowned mill owner, postmaster, merchant and politician. He built this impressive mansion, complete with a wing to house his servants. Supposedly, Sir John A MacDonald and Sir Charles Tupper were frequent guests of the Denaut's. Now it is an inn where you can sleep in a room previously occupied by Sir John, eh?
